The period from 1999 to 2002 saw critical US Shuttle missions advancing space exploration and International Space Station (ISS) construction. Key missions included STS-93 in 1999, notable for deploying the Chandra X-ray Observatory, enhancing space-based astronomical capabilities. The year 2000 featured several ISS assembly flights, including STS-97, which installed the P6 truss, providing power through solar arrays. In 2001, significant flights like STS-100 transported the Canadarm2 robotic arm, crucial for ISS construction and maintenance. The concluding year, 2002, had missions such as STS-113, which delivered the P1 truss segment to the ISS, further expanding its structure. These missions collectively bolstered the ISS framework, facilitated scientific research, and showcased international cooperation in space endeavors.

STS-100 in April 2001 played a pivotal role with the delivery of the Canadarm2, a sophisticated robotic arm critical for the ISS's assembly and maintenance. Following this, STS-104 in July 2001 added the Quest Joint Airlock, enabling astronauts to conduct spacewalks from the ISS using both Russian and American spacesuits. These missions underpinned the international collaboration that has become the hallmark of the ISS.
However, this period was not without challenges. The shuttle program faced ongoing scrutiny over safety protocols, highlighted by the tragic loss of the Space Shuttle Columbia on STS-107 in February 2003, just outside our discussed range but casting a shadow backward over prior missions and sparking extensive reviews of the shuttle's future.
Each mission between 1999 and 2002 contributed uniquely to space science, not only advancing our technological capabilities and scientific knowledge but also preparing the groundwork for the ISS to become the world-renowned laboratory it is today. The era encapsulated both triumphant achievements and crucial lessons, propelling human spaceflight into the 21st century.
